Attractions and Places To See around Flachsee - Top 8

Best attractions and places to see around Flachsee include this artificial lake located south of Bremgarten in the Aargau region of Switzerland. Formed by the damming of the Reuss River, Flachsee is a 72-hectare reservoir recognized as a significant nature reserve. It is particularly known for its diverse birdlife and tranquil landscapes, offering opportunities for hiking, cycling, and birdwatching. The area provides a serene escape with natural beauty and recreational activities.

The jammed Reuss created a five kilometers long and 350 meters wide lake, which is today a water bird sanctuary. The marshes and islands are a habitat for rare waterfowl. …

Frequently Asked Questions

What natural features and wildlife can I observe around Flachsee?

The Flachsee area is a significant nature reserve, particularly known for its diverse flora and fauna. You can observe over 240 bird species, including grey herons, cormorants, and greylag geese, especially at the Flachsee Nature Reserve. The extensive marshlands, backwaters, and small islands provide habitats for various wildlife, and beavers have also re-established themselves in the area. The Rottenschwiler Moos, southwest of Flachsee, showcases remnants of the Reuss River's original meanders.

Are there opportunities for birdwatching at Flachsee?

Yes, Flachsee is renowned as a bird sanctuary. You can enjoy birdwatching year-round from elevated observation areas and a dedicated facility like the Birdwatching Hide at Flachsee Waterbird Reserve. With a little patience, you can spot many species of waterfowl and other birds.

What historical or cultural sites are worth visiting near Flachsee?

Near Flachsee, you can visit the Old Iron Bridge over the Reuss River in Rottenschwil, which adds a charming historical character to the landscape. Additionally, the historic town of Bremgarten, located about 4 km north, is easily accessible and offers a rich history and numerous sights worth exploring. Hermetschwil Abbey is also mentioned in some hiking routes, suggesting nearby cultural significance.

How can I get to Flachsee by public transport or car?

Flachsee is easily accessible. If traveling by car, public parking is available near the Rottenschwil Bridge. For those using public transport, Flachsee can be reached from Bremgarten train station, which is about a 30-minute walk away.
